Fatehabad Leads Haryana Poll Turnout at 74.8%

by The_unmuteenglish

Chandigarh: Fatehabad district saw the highest voter turnout in Haryana at 74.8%, followed by Sirsa at 74.6% and Yamunanagar at 74.1%, according to the Election Commission of India (ECI).

Faridabad recorded the lowest turnout with only 55.9%. Gurugram, with four assembly seats, also witnessed low participation, with 57.8% voter turnout, 2.77% lower than in 2019.

While polling remained mostly peaceful, minor scuffles were reported. In Charkhi Dadri, residents of Ramalwas village boycotted voting to protest against illegal mining in the area, citing unaddressed complaints to authorities.
